UPVC Window Repair Near Me

Windows are an essential element of any home. They help keep water, air, noise, and contaminants out. However, they can fail or become damaged over time. In some instances, professional repairs may be required to address these issues.

UPVC windows have become popular due to their strength and low maintenance requirements. They can also save money on your energy bills.

A gap between the sash's frame and the frame could be the reason for your windows that are not closing properly. This can lead to draughts, but it can also cause water damage and damp. To determine this, try putting a piece of paper between the frame and the sash to see if it can be closed.

To fix the issue, you'll need to take off the seals surrounding the frame and the sash. The next step is to remove the locking mechanism from its place within the frame. To get the gearbox out you'll need an open-ended screwdriver or torch. After you have removed your gearbox, you'll need to replace it with a new one of the same type and size.

Repair UPVC window frames

If your uPVC windows are damaged, have cracks or holes, or an unsound window seal, it's important to fix the problem as soon as you notice it. These issues can cause the glass to fog and can also cause water leaks. In addition, the damage to the frames could decrease the insulation value of your home, which can result in higher energy bills. Fortunately, most of these issues can be addressed with simple DIY repairs or by hiring a professional with experience.

UPVC window repair is more economical than replacing the entire window, however there are situations where it's better to replace the entire unit. This is especially true if the frame has been damaged beyond repair. There are several factors that impact the cost of UPVC window replacement, such as material type and the amount of work required. A complete replacement will cost between $100 and $1,000 for a window, and the cost will vary depending on the extent of the damage and whether it is necessary to replace the window.

Cleaning UPVC windows is crucial to keep out moisture and dirt buildup. This will allow you to avoid costly repairs down the road. Generally speaking, it is recommended to do this two times a year. You can also use WD-40 to grease the moving parts of your UPVC window. Before cleaning the frame, it's best to remove any cobwebs or dust with a soft bristle brush. You can also sand any scuff marks on frames to make them appear new.
